The Heavy Toll of the Tracks: Unraveling the Link Between Railroads, Asthma, and Settlements

For generations, the rhythmic rumble of locomotives and the huge network of trains have been synonymous with progress, connecting neighborhoods and driving economies. However, underneath the veneer of commercial advancement lies a less discussed and often ignored repercussion: the extensive effect of the railroad market on breathing health, especially the advancement and worsening of asthma. This short article delves into the complex connection in between railroad work, property distance to railways, and asthma, checking out the historical context, the underlying environmental factors, and the legal landscape of settlements that have actually become a result of this detrimental link.

Historically, the railroad market was defined by harsh working conditions and significant environmental pollution. From the steam-powered period to the diesel age, workers and communities living alongside railway lines were exposed to a complex cocktail of toxins. These exposures, frequently extended and extreme, have actually been significantly recognized as powerful triggers for asthma, a chronic respiratory illness identified by inflammation and narrowing of the air passages, resulting in wheezing, coughing, shortness of breath, and chest tightness.

Understanding the Railroad-Asthma Connection

The association in between railways and asthma is multifaceted, incorporating both occupational and environmental factors. Let's explore the crucial elements:

1. Occupational Hazards for Railroad Workers:

For those used in the railroad market, the danger of developing asthma and other breathing diseases is considerably elevated due to direct exposure to a variety of harmful compounds. These occupational health Hazards dangers include:

  • Diesel Exhaust: Diesel engines, the workhorses of contemporary rail transport, emit a complicated mix of gases and particulate matter. Diesel exhaust particles are recognized asthma sets off, efficient in triggering air passage swelling and exacerbating pre-existing respiratory conditions. Employees in lawns, maintenance centers, and even engine engineers in older designs face significant direct exposure.
  • Asbestos: Historically, asbestos was thoroughly used in locomotives, rail cars, and infrastructure for insulation and fireproofing. Railroad employees, especially mechanics, carmen, and those involved in demolition or repair, were exposed to asbestos fibers. Asbestos is a well-established cause of lung illness, consisting of asbestosis, lung workplace cancer compensation, and mesothelioma cases, but it can also contribute to asthma and respiratory tract irritation.
  • Silica Dust: Track maintenance and building and construction activities produce significant amounts of silica dust, specifically throughout ballast handling and grinding operations. Inhaling crystalline silica can result in silicosis, a severe lung disease, and can also aggravate the airways, making individuals more prone to asthma and other respiratory issues.
  • Coal Dust: In the age of steam engines and even in contemporary coal transportation, coal dust exposure has actually been and continues to be an issue. Breathing in coal dust can trigger coal employee's pneumoconiosis ("black lung") and contribute to chronic bronchitis and asthma.
  • Creosote and Wood Preservatives: Creosote, a preservative utilized to treat wooden railroad ties, releases unpredictable natural compounds (VOCs) and polycyclic aromatic hydrocarbons (PAHs). These chemicals are breathing irritants and prospective asthma triggers. Employees handling cured ties or working in locations where creosote is utilized may be exposed.
  • Welding Fumes: Welding is a typical practice in railroad maintenance and repair. Welding fumes consist of metal particles and gases that can aggravate the breathing system and add to asthma development, particularly in welders and those working in proximity to welding activities.
  • Mold and Biological Agents: In damp or improperly ventilated railway environments, mold development can occur, releasing spores that are potent allergens and asthma triggers.

2. Ecological Impacts on Residents Near Railroads:

Beyond occupational threats, living near railroad tracks or freight yards can also increase the danger of asthma and breathing issues due to ecological contamination:

  • Air Pollution from Trains: Train operations, especially in freight yards and heavily trafficked corridors, add to local air contamination. Diesel exhaust from locomotives, in addition to particulate matter from brake dust and the resuspension of track debris, can break down air quality and exacerbate asthma in nearby communities, especially impacting children and the elderly.
  • Sound pollution: While not directly triggering asthma, chronic noise contamination from trains can contribute to tension and sleep disruptions, which can indirectly impact immune function and potentially make individuals more susceptible to breathing diseases or exacerbate status quo.
  • Distance to Industrial Sites: Railroads often run through or near industrial areas, freight yards, and railyards. These places can be sources of extra air pollutants, consisting of industrial emissions and fugitive dust, which can even more add to breathing issues in surrounding suburbs.

The Legal Landscape and Settlements

Recognizing the damaging health impacts connected with railroad work and living environments, affected individuals have looked for legal recourse to obtain settlement for their suffering and medical expenses. The legal landscape in the United States, especially worrying railroad worker health, is often governed by the Federal Employers Liability Act (FELA).

FELA, unlike state workers' settlement laws, enables railroad workers to sue their employers for neglect if they can prove that their employer's carelessness caused their injury or health problem. This has actually been a crucial opportunity for railroad employees suffering from asthma and other breathing diseases to look for settlements from railroad companies.

Settlements in railroad asthma cases typically include showing a direct link in between the worker's direct exposure to harmful compounds and the advancement or exacerbation of their asthma. This can be complex and needs medical documentation, expert testament, and typically, historical records of working conditions and possible direct exposures at particular railroad sites.

For citizens living near railways, legal opportunities for settlements are frequently less specified and may involve environmental toxic tort litigation claims or class-action lawsuits versus railroad business or accountable parties for environmental contamination. These cases can be challenging, needing comprehensive clinical evidence to establish a direct causal link in between railroad-related contamination and asthma in a specific community.

Ongoing Concerns and Mitigation Efforts

While awareness of the health risks connected with railroads and asthma has actually grown, and regulations have been implemented in some areas, issues stay. Modern diesel locomotives are usually cleaner than older models, and some railroads are exploring alternative fuels and technologies to decrease emissions. However, tradition contamination from previous practices and continuous exposures in particular occupations still posture risks.

Efforts to alleviate the impact of railways on asthma include:

  • Improved Ventilation and Respiratory Protection: In occupational settings, executing better ventilation systems in maintenance facilities and offering respirators to workers exposed to dust, diesel exhaust, and other airborne hazards can decrease exposure levels.
  • Emission Reduction Technologies: Railroad companies are adopting cleaner diesel engines, exploring alternative fuels like biofuels and hydrogen, and executing innovations like diesel particulate filters to reduce emissions.
  • Ecological Monitoring and Regulations: Increased tracking of air quality near railway lines and stricter environmental regulations for railroad operations can help secure communities from pollution.
  • Land Use Planning and Buffer Zones: Urban planning that integrates buffer zones between residential areas and significant railway lines or freight yards can help lessen direct exposure to noise and air contamination.
  • Medical Surveillance and Early Detection: Implementing medical surveillance programs for railroad workers and residents in high-risk locations can help identify breathing issues early and facilitate timely intervention and treatment.

Regularly Asked Questions (FAQs)

Q1: What are the main compounds in the railroad environment that can activate asthma?

A1: Key asthma sets off in the railroad environment include diesel exhaust, asbestos fibers, silica dust, coal dust, creosote fumes, welding fumes, and mold spores.

Q2: Are all railroad employees at risk of developing asthma?

A2: While all railroad workers might deal with some level of exposure, those in particular occupations such as mechanics, carmen, track upkeep workers, yard workers, and engineers (particularly in older locomotives) are at greater threat due to more direct and prolonged exposure to hazardous compounds.

Q3: Can living near railroad tracks cause asthma?

A3: Yes, research studies have actually shown that living near busy railway lines or freight yards can increase the risk of asthma, particularly in kids and vulnerable populations, due to air contamination from diesel exhaust and particulate matter.

Q4: What is FELA, and how does it relate to railroad employee asthma?

A4: FELA (Federal Employers Liability Act) is a federal law that enables railroad employees to sue their companies for negligence if they are injured on the job, consisting of developing diseases like asthma due to hazardous working conditions.

Q5: What kind of settlements can railroad employees with asthma receive?

A5: Settlements can vary widely depending upon the intensity of the asthma, the extent of exposure, medical costs, lost wages, and the strength of evidence demonstrating the causal link in between railroad work and asthma. Settlements can cover medical costs, lost income, discomfort and suffering, and other damages.

Q6: Are there any guidelines in place to safeguard railroad employees and neighborhoods from asthma-causing toxins?

A6: Yes, there are policies from firms like OSHA (Occupational Safety and Health Administration) and EPA (Environmental Protection Agency) that aim to restrict direct exposure to harmful substances in the workplace safety standards and the environment. Nevertheless, enforcement and effectiveness can vary, and continuous advocacy is required to strengthen defenses.

Q7: What can be done to minimize the risk of railroad-related asthma?

A7: Risk decrease procedures include:

  • Using cleaner locomotive innovations and fuels.
  • Improving ventilation and breathing defense for workers.
  • Executing dust control measures during track maintenance.
  • Monitoring air quality near railways.
  • Producing buffer zones between railways and suburbs.
  • Promoting medical monitoring and early detection of respiratory problems.
